diff --git a/assets/js/sections/common.js b/assets/js/sections/common.js
index 76508f5f..c0c84491 100644
--- a/assets/js/sections/common.js
+++ b/assets/js/sections/common.js
@@ -430,4 +430,21 @@ function getLookupResult() {
$(".ld-ext-right").prop('disabled', false);
}
});
+}
+
+// This function executes the call to the backend for fetching dxcc summary and inserted table below qso entry
+function getDxccResult(dxcc) {
+ $.ajax({
+ url: base_url + 'index.php/lookup/search',
+ type: 'post',
+ data: {
+ type: 'dxcc',
+ dxcc: dxcc,
+ },
+ success: function (html) {
+ $('.dxccsummary').remove();
+ $('.qsopane').append('
');
+ $('.dxccsummarybody').append(html);
+ }
+ });
}
\ No newline at end of file
diff --git a/assets/js/sections/qso.js b/assets/js/sections/qso.js
index 7091aaf7..74d08c8c 100644
--- a/assets/js/sections/qso.js
+++ b/assets/js/sections/qso.js
@@ -406,6 +406,7 @@ $("#callsign").focusout(function() {
if(result.dxcc.entity != undefined) {
$('#country').val(convert_case(result.dxcc.entity));
$('#callsign_info').text(convert_case(result.dxcc.entity));
+ getDxccResult(convert_case(result.dxcc.adif));
if($("#sat_name" ).val() != "") {
//logbook/jsonlookupgrid/io77/SAT/0/0
From 79800f73bc78f19f77f929f40469b3fa7b6a8baa Mon Sep 17 00:00:00 2001
From: Andreas <6977712+AndreasK79@users.noreply.github.com>
Date: Thu, 26 Jan 2023 09:02:44 +0100
Subject: [PATCH 02/11] [QSO Entry] Bugfix for dxcc none.
---
assets/js/sections/qso.js |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/assets/js/sections/qso.js b/assets/js/sections/qso.js
index 74d08c8c..c5da4ada 100644
--- a/assets/js/sections/qso.js
+++ b/assets/js/sections/qso.js
@@ -406,7 +406,7 @@ $("#callsign").focusout(function() {
if(result.dxcc.entity != undefined) {
$('#country').val(convert_case(result.dxcc.entity));
$('#callsign_info').text(convert_case(result.dxcc.entity));
- getDxccResult(convert_case(result.dxcc.adif));
+ getDxccResult(result.dxcc.adif);
if($("#sat_name" ).val() != "") {
//logbook/jsonlookupgrid/io77/SAT/0/0
From 7dd9ef13d74605eb3e14f68949e352907768f475 Mon Sep 17 00:00:00 2001
From: Andreas <6977712+AndreasK79@users.noreply.github.com>
Date: Thu, 26 Jan 2023 09:10:56 +0100
Subject: [PATCH 03/11] [QSO Entry] Added removing of summary when resetting
---
assets/js/sections/qso.js | 2 ++
1 file changed, 2 insertions(+)
diff --git a/assets/js/sections/qso.js b/assets/js/sections/qso.js
index c5da4ada..f3f7b8c0 100644
--- a/assets/js/sections/qso.js
+++ b/assets/js/sections/qso.js
@@ -368,6 +368,7 @@ function reset_fields() {
mymap.setView(pos, 12);
mymap.removeLayer(markers);
$('.callsign-suggest').hide();
+ $('.dxccsummary').remove();
}
$("#callsign").focusout(function() {
@@ -788,4 +789,5 @@ function resetDefaultQSOFields() {
$('#input_usa_state').val("");
$('#callsign-image').attr('style', 'display: none;');
$('#callsign-image-content').text("");
+ $('.dxccsummary').remove();
}
From 8ea9c04141539ba374af4662c48bd0ba3c6e82a2 Mon Sep 17 00:00:00 2001
From: Andreas <6977712+AndreasK79@users.noreply.github.com>
Date: Thu, 26 Jan 2023 09:20:45 +0100
Subject: [PATCH 04/11] [QSO Entry] Added dxcc name to card header
---
assets/js/sections/common.js | 4 ++--
assets/js/sections/qso.js | 2 +-
2 files changed, 3 insertions(+), 3 deletions(-)
diff --git a/assets/js/sections/common.js b/assets/js/sections/common.js
index c0c84491..2edb942f 100644
--- a/assets/js/sections/common.js
+++ b/assets/js/sections/common.js
@@ -433,7 +433,7 @@ function getLookupResult() {
}
// This function executes the call to the backend for fetching dxcc summary and inserted table below qso entry
-function getDxccResult(dxcc) {
+function getDxccResult(dxcc, name) {
$.ajax({
url: base_url + 'index.php/lookup/search',
type: 'post',
@@ -443,7 +443,7 @@ function getDxccResult(dxcc) {
},
success: function (html) {
$('.dxccsummary').remove();
- $('.qsopane').append('
');
+ $('.qsopane').append('
');
$('.dxccsummarybody').append(html);
}
});
diff --git a/assets/js/sections/qso.js b/assets/js/sections/qso.js
index f3f7b8c0..d0f0b706 100644
--- a/assets/js/sections/qso.js
+++ b/assets/js/sections/qso.js
@@ -407,7 +407,7 @@ $("#callsign").focusout(function() {
if(result.dxcc.entity != undefined) {
$('#country').val(convert_case(result.dxcc.entity));
$('#callsign_info').text(convert_case(result.dxcc.entity));
- getDxccResult(result.dxcc.adif);
+ getDxccResult(result.dxcc.adif, convert_case(result.dxcc.entity));
if($("#sat_name" ).val() != "") {
//logbook/jsonlookupgrid/io77/SAT/0/0
From 3dde2cb22152ee6e5feab3fa49249b2ec2b4d2b5 Mon Sep 17 00:00:00 2001
From: Andreas <6977712+AndreasK79@users.noreply.github.com>
Date: Fri, 27 Jan 2023 09:23:42 +0100
Subject: [PATCH 05/11] [QSO Entry] Added collapse on dxcc summary card
---
assets/js/sections/common.js |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/assets/js/sections/common.js b/assets/js/sections/common.js
index 2edb942f..b0cbdc26 100644
--- a/assets/js/sections/common.js
+++ b/assets/js/sections/common.js
@@ -443,7 +443,7 @@ function getDxccResult(dxcc, name) {
},
success: function (html) {
$('.dxccsummary').remove();
- $('.qsopane').append('
');
+ $('.qsopane').append('
');
$('.dxccsummarybody').append(html);
}
});
From c56c21b6110dd07e7470dccd38432090d5673522 Mon Sep 17 00:00:00 2001
From: phl0
Date: Mon, 30 Jan 2023 15:54:57 +0100
Subject: [PATCH 06/11] Add some Cloudlog info to debug page (hopefully useful
for future debugging)
---
application/views/debug/main.php | 22 +++++++++++++++++++++-
1 file changed, 21 insertions(+), 1 deletion(-)
diff --git a/application/views/debug/main.php b/application/views/debug/main.php
index 3aecd461..087fe004 100644
--- a/application/views/debug/main.php
+++ b/application/views/debug/main.php
@@ -5,6 +5,26 @@
+
+
+
+
+
+ | Version |
+ config->item('app_version')."\n"; ?> |
+
+
+ | Language |
+ config->item('language')."\n"; ?> |
+
+
+ | Base URL |
+ config->item('base_url')."\n"; ?> |
+
+
+
+
+
-
\ No newline at end of file
+
From b9b0d0e4832e6cf5d9e2695b34ebdeec6aa745bc Mon Sep 17 00:00:00 2001
From: phl0
Date: Tue, 31 Jan 2023 13:00:23 +0100
Subject: [PATCH 07/11] Make base URL copyable
---
application/views/debug/main.php | 4 ++--
application/views/interface_assets/footer.php | 18 ++++++++++++++++++
2 files changed, 20 insertions(+), 2 deletions(-)
diff --git a/application/views/debug/main.php b/application/views/debug/main.php
index 087fe004..bfffc7dc 100644
--- a/application/views/debug/main.php
+++ b/application/views/debug/main.php
@@ -15,11 +15,11 @@
| Language |
- config->item('language')."\n"; ?> |
+ config->item('language'))."\n"; ?> |
| Base URL |
- config->item('base_url')."\n"; ?> |
+ config->item('base_url'); ?> ")'> |
diff --git a/application/views/interface_assets/footer.php b/application/views/interface_assets/footer.php
index 8b5b716a..68b731e5 100644
--- a/application/views/interface_assets/footer.php
+++ b/application/views/interface_assets/footer.php
@@ -122,6 +122,24 @@ function load_was_map() {
+uri->segment(1) == "debug") { ?>
+
+
+
uri->segment(1) == "api" && $this->uri->segment(2) == "help") { ?>